From Ira : http://www.sun-sentinel.com/sports/miami-heat/sfl-askira,0,4255444.story
Q: Pat Riley is slowly killing the Miami Heat. First with the Chris Bosh max salary, then with Birdman's $10 million dollar, two-year year salary and then he signs Udonis Haslem to a two-year $5.6 million dollar deal! WOW! I could have built a better team. -- Bruno, Fort Lauderdale.
A: First, some of that was for bills past due, such as Chris Andersen playing for the below-market minimum the past two seasons, and for Haslem opting out of the final year of his deal to accommodate the Heat's "room" salary-cap exception. The real contract to keep an eye out on is Bosh's. Can he play well enough to attract free agents in 2016, or will his salary weigh down the Heat in the fourth and fifth years of his deal? It is a question without an immediate answer.
